Description

Job Type Full-time Description FLEXTRADES is a rapidly growing national provider of production solutions recognized by Staffing Industry Analysts as a 2026 Best Place to Work. We are seeking a highly motivated Demand Generation Associate, Technician Marketing to join our Marketing team. In this role, you'll be a key player in executing multi-channel programs, with heavy emphasis on email marketing initiatives, that generate pipeline and support our technical recruiting team. You will report to the Vice President of Marketing and collaborate across marketing, recruiting, leadership, and sales to optimize the technician journey-from first touch to closed deal. Duties & Responsibilities: • Program Development: create and launch new demand generation initiatives focused on technician acquisition and bench re-engagement. • Email Marketing: plan, build, and optimize email marketing campaigns to nurture leads and drive engagement across the funnel. • Digital Marketing: manage and optimize the efficient use of job boards and company review sites to drive brand awareness, improve acquisition, and identify skilled technicians aligned to client demand. • Communications: drive candidate communication programs, newsletters, spotlights, and related programs to build a loyal, long-term technician community. • Candidate Flow Optimization: collaboration with recruiting and marketing to streamline and optimize lead handoffs, scoring, and funnel progression. • Reporting & Analysis: own campaign reporting; analyze performance metrics; share insights to improve open rates, application rates, click-through rates, conversions, and pipeline impact. • Content: coordinate and work closely with team members to develop creative content for marketing initiatives. • Explore new channels to expand footprint and alignment with key technician segments including, but not limited to, sociations, career fairs, trade schools, etc. • All other duties as assigned. Requirements • Bachelor's degree in marketing, communications, business, or similar discipline. • 4+ years of experience in service-driven demand generation, B2B and B2C marketing, or growth marketing roles. • Deep knowledge of email marketing, including list segmentation, deliverability, A/B testing, and reporting. • Hands-on experience with job boards and related candidate acquisition channels as well as review sites. • Strong analytical skills and proficiency with back-end communication and reporting systems and tools (e.g., Bullhorn, Canvas, Salesforce, Google Analytics, Excel, etc.). • Excellent project management skills and attention to detail. • Strong collaboration and communication skills, with a cross-functional mindset. Preferred Experience: • Bullhorn experience is highly preferred. • Experience in manufacturing, industrial staffing, workforce solutions, or similar is a plus.
